The cheapest way to get from Ipanema to Maracanã (Station) is to line 432 bus which costs R$ 5 and takes 54 min.
The fastest way to get from Ipanema to Maracanã (Station) is to taxi which takes 13 min and costs R$ 50 - R$ 65.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from BRS 1,2,3: Vinícius de Moraes and arriving at Visconde de Itamarati.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 54 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from General Osorio and arriving at Saens Pena.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 32 min.
The distance between Ipanema and Maracanã (Station) is 17 km. The road distance is 13 km.
The best way to get from Ipanema to Maracanã (Station) without a car is to Metrô Rio which takes 37 min and costs R$ 7 - R$ 9.
The Metrô Rio from General Osorio to Saens Pena takes 32 min including transfers and departs every five minutes.

Metro Rio operates a subway from General Osorio to Saens Pena every 5 minutes. Tickets cost R$7–9 and the journey takes 32 min. Alternatively, Intersul operates a bus from BRS 1,2,3: Vinícius de Moraes to Visconde de Itamarati every 30 minutes. Tickets cost R$5 and the journey takes 54 min.
